About Seido Nagano

Seido Nagano is a scholar working on Surfaces, Coatings and Films,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Condensed Matter Physics, having authored 40 papers that have together received 436 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(11 papers), Nonlinear Dynamics and Pattern Formation (9 papers) and Quantum, superfluid, helium dynamics (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Condensed Matter Physics (87 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(193 citations) and Surfaces, Coatings and Films (39 citations). Seido Nagano has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Poland. Frequent co-authors include K. S. Singwi, Hiroyuki Takata, Shuhei Ohnishi, S. Y. Tong, Setsuo Ichimaru, Masaru Tsukiji, Eiji HASEGAWA, K. Ando, Akihiko Ishitani and Naoki Itoh.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review Letters, The Journal of Chemical Physics and Physical review. B, Condensed matter.
